#9c349b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c349b is composed of 61.2% red, 20.4%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 0.6%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 300.6 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 40.8%. #9c349b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ff68ff with #390037.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#9c349b color description : Dark moderate magenta.

#9c349b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9c349b has RGB values of R:156, G:52,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.01,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10237083.

Shades and Tints of #9c349b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090309 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c349b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c646c is the less saturated color, while #cc04ca is the most saturated one.
